February 26; Matthew 7:11; 7/260(IV); ‘Bad Doing Good’
Matthew 7:11 If you then, being evil, know how to give good gifts to your children, how much more will your Father who is in heaven give good things to those who ask Him!
The word evil is not as bad as it sounds. It basically means we can be carnal people at times. Having said that, this verse should boost your faith. If natural humans, flawed as we may be, desire to give our children good gifts and this is normally the case for ‘normal’ parents, how much more does God the Father, who loves us as much as He loves Jesus (John 17:23), give good things to us when we ask. No one wants the best for you more than the Father in heaven. The Bible tells us in several verses that He loves to bless us. He wants you to get this deep into your spirit, so that when you do pray and ask Him for something, you will have faith that He will give it to you. I always loved the look on my son’s faces when we gave them something that they really wanted. I know that the Father has a big grin of His face when we, in faith, ask Him for something and He graciously gives it to us. No one will ever love us as much as God the Father. He proved His love when He sent the Lord Jesus Christ to redeem us from our sins and sicknesses. The Bible teaches that if He did not spare Jesus, but sent Him to pay our price, He will surely give us all things to enjoy (Romans 8:32). The Bible also teaches us that we cannot please the Lord without faith (Hebrews 11:6), so we must believe that He truly desires to bless us, His children. There are two things that we must be careful about, not asking for things in a greedy manner and making sure that what we ask the Father for is biblical. You can clearly see in the Word that the Father loves to bless us. Keep Him first in your life, always be grateful when He answers your prayers and absolutely know He loves to bless you.
